**Managers Only — Fennick Range Pricing**

Restricted page. Do not share outside branch management.

Fennick Tools pricing resets on the first of next quarter. Core SKUs: +3%. Premium Fennick Pro line: +6%. Clearance tier: unchanged. No branch-level discretion above 5% discount without regional sign-off. Trade accounts move to the new rate card automatically; honour existing quotes for 30 days only. Display pricing must be updated before open of business on changeover day. Rationale for the reset appears in the note below.

internal memo for kawip-hadug: Headcount on the Wenwyn team goes from 7 to 140 by the end of January. Gross margin on Wenwyn came in at 20 percent against a plan of 15 percent.

## Loyalty-Points Ledger: Limits and Quotas

For this week's sync: the Mirastone ledger now enforces hard caps on accrual bursts and redemption batch sizes to keep reconciliation deterministic. Any change to these caps requires a migration note and sign-off from the payments rotation, since downstream settlement jobs assume them. Please review carefully before proposing adjustments. The current enforced constants are as follows.

tuning constants:
QUOTAS = {
    "druwyn": 5,
    "holix": 5,
    "zorath": 5,
    "holwyn": 10,
}

Action item: The Relayn deploy-status bot silently dropped updates when the pipeline API paginated results, so responders believed a rollback had completed when it had not. We will add pagination handling, a staleness banner, and an integration test. Until merged, verify deploy state directly in the pipeline console, documented at the page below.

runbook for kahop-kajop: https://rundeck.ordinio.test/display/secrets/pipeline/issue/pages/repo/browse/e5732776e07d1285107e5aeb

Vendor note for the release manager: Hartwick Analytics, supplier of the Ledgerloom report builder, has confirmed that sort operations in version 4.2 are not stable — rows with equal keys may reorder between runs, which broke our regression snapshots. They have committed to a stable-sort patch in 4.3, expected next cycle. Please hold certification of any release embedding 4.2 until the patch lands. Their support desk can be reached at the address below.

escalation mailbox, bafog-fafog: ulador@paliqlabs.internal